National Lottery in Pakistan: A Cultural Insight
The national lottery in Pakistan, often referred to as the Pakistan National Lottery, is a popular form of gambling that has been integrated into the local culture. It offers participants the chance to win substantial prizes through random draws, which are typically held regularly. This system is managed by government authorities to ensure fairness and transparency.In Pakistani society, the national lottery is seen by many as a way to potentially improve financial situations, especially in regions with economic challenges. However, it is important to note that gambling is viewed with caution in Islamic teachings, which dominate the cultural landscape. As a result, while the lottery is legal and regulated, it is often discussed in the context of moral and religious considerations.
From a cultural perspective, the national lottery has influenced various aspects of daily life, including entertainment and social interactions. Many people participate in lottery schemes as a form of hope or leisure, and it has become a topic in local media and conversations. Despite its popularity, there is ongoing debate about its impact on society, balancing economic benefits with ethical concerns.
